Understanding What Causes for Dizziness?

Dizziness is a common complaint that can range from a mild feeling of lightheadedness to severe vertigo, where the world seems to spin uncontrollably. The sensation itself is not a disease but a symptom of an underlying problem. To truly grasp what causes for dizziness, it’s essential to understand the body’s balance system and how various factors can interfere with it.

Our sense of balance depends on three primary systems working together: the inner ear (vestibular system), the eyes (visual system), and the sensory nerves in muscles and joints (proprioceptive system). When these systems send conflicting signals to the brain or fail to communicate properly, dizziness occurs. This disruption can stem from numerous causes ranging from simple dehydration to complex neurological disorders.

Inner Ear and Vestibular Causes

The inner ear plays a pivotal role in maintaining balance. It contains semicircular canals filled with fluid that detect head movements and send signals to the brain about orientation. When this system malfunctions, dizziness or vertigo often follows.

Common vestibular causes include:

    • Benign Paroxysmal Positional Vertigo (BPPV): Tiny calcium crystals in the inner ear become dislodged and move into semicircular canals, triggering brief episodes of spinning dizziness when the head changes position.
    • Meniere’s Disease: Excess fluid buildup in the inner ear leads to vertigo attacks, hearing loss, tinnitus (ringing in ears), and a feeling of fullness.
    • Vestibular Neuritis/Labyrinthitis: Viral infections inflame the inner ear or vestibular nerve, causing sudden severe vertigo accompanied by nausea and imbalance.

These conditions affect how balance information is relayed to the brain, making it hard for your body to stay oriented.

Circulatory System and Blood Flow Issues

Another major cause of dizziness lies in impaired blood flow to the brain. The brain requires a steady supply of oxygen-rich blood; any drop can result in lightheadedness or fainting sensations.

Key circulatory causes include:

    • Orthostatic Hypotension: A sudden drop in blood pressure when standing up quickly reduces blood flow to the brain momentarily.
    • Anemia: Low red blood cell count means less oxygen delivery throughout your body, including your brain.
    • Heart Problems: Conditions like arrhythmia or heart failure can reduce cardiac output causing dizziness due to insufficient cerebral blood flow.
    • Dehydration: Loss of fluids lowers blood volume leading to hypotension and feelings of faintness.

These factors cause transient or ongoing episodes where your brain struggles with inadequate perfusion.

Neurological Factors Behind Dizziness

The nervous system controls balance by processing input from sensory organs and coordinating muscle responses. Damage or dysfunction here can lead to dizziness.

Neurological causes include:

    • Migraine-Associated Vertigo: Migraines sometimes affect vestibular pathways causing dizziness alongside headaches.
    • Multiple Sclerosis (MS): Demyelination disrupts nerve signals involved in balance control.
    • Cerebellar Disorders: The cerebellum manages coordination; lesions here cause unsteady gait and dizziness.
    • Stroke or Transient Ischemic Attack (TIA): Reduced blood flow or bleeding affecting balance centers triggers sudden dizziness with other neurological symptoms.

These conditions often require thorough medical evaluation due to their complexity.

Differentiating Types of Dizziness

Not all dizziness feels alike. Identifying its character helps pinpoint what causes for dizziness.

Lightheadedness vs Vertigo vs Disequilibrium

    • Lightheadedness: A faint feeling as if you might pass out; often linked with low blood pressure or dehydration.
    • Vertigo: A false sensation of spinning either of yourself or surroundings; typically caused by inner ear problems.
    • Disequilibrium: A sense of imbalance or unsteadiness while walking; commonly related to neurological or musculoskeletal issues.

Knowing these distinctions guides appropriate diagnosis and treatment strategies.

The Role of Medications and Lifestyle Factors

Sometimes what causes for dizziness isn’t an illness but external influences like medications or lifestyle habits that affect your body’s equilibrium mechanisms.

Medications That Can Trigger Dizziness

Many drugs list dizziness as a side effect due to their impact on blood pressure, central nervous system function, or inner ear sensitivity. Common culprits include:

    • Benzodiazepines and sedatives: These depress nervous system activity causing drowsiness and imbalance.
    • Blood pressure medications: Overly aggressive lowering can cause orthostatic hypotension.
    • Aminoglycoside antibiotics: Known for ototoxicity affecting inner ear function.
    • Chemotherapy agents: Some damage nerves involved in balance control.

Always consult your doctor if you suspect your medication is behind dizzy spells.

Lifestyle Triggers for Dizziness

Certain behaviors can increase dizziness risk:

    • Poor hydration: Not drinking enough water reduces blood volume causing faintness.
    • Poor nutrition: Skipping meals lowers blood sugar which may lead to lightheadedness.
    • Lack of sleep: Fatigue impairs brain function including balance processing centers.
    • Caffeine and alcohol use: Both can disrupt inner ear fluid dynamics and dehydration status.

Adjusting these factors often improves symptoms significantly.

The Importance of Diagnosis: Tests That Reveal What Causes for Dizziness?

Pinpointing exactly what causes for dizziness requires careful evaluation since many conditions share similar symptoms. Doctors rely on history-taking combined with physical exams and diagnostic tests.

Tilt Table Test for Blood Pressure Issues

This test monitors how your heart rate and blood pressure respond when moving from lying down to standing up. It helps diagnose orthostatic hypotension or neurocardiogenic syncope—common reasons behind dizzy spells upon standing.

Bithermal Caloric Testing & Videonystagmography (VNG)

These tests evaluate inner ear function by stimulating each ear canal with warm and cold water or air while tracking eye movements. Abnormal responses indicate vestibular dysfunction like BPPV or labyrinthitis.

MRI/CT Scans for Neurological Causes

Imaging helps identify strokes, tumors, MS plaques, or cerebellar lesions that could disrupt balance pathways within the brainstem or cerebellum.

Blood Tests for Anemia & Metabolic Disorders

Checking hemoglobin levels rules out anemia while glucose tests detect hypoglycemia as potential contributors to lightheadedness.

Treatment Options Based on What Causes for Dizziness?

Since dizziness stems from diverse origins, treatment must be tailored accordingly. There’s no one-size-fits-all fix here.

Treating Inner Ear Problems Effectively

For BPPV—the most common vestibular cause—simple repositioning maneuvers like Epley’s maneuver reposition displaced crystals back where they belong. This procedure is quick and often resolves symptoms immediately.

Infections such as vestibular neuritis may require corticosteroids alongside anti-nausea medications during acute phases. Meniere’s disease treatment focuses on reducing fluid buildup through low-salt diets, diuretics, and sometimes surgery if severe.

Coping With Circulatory-Related Dizziness

Lifestyle adjustments form the backbone here—staying well-hydrated throughout the day prevents drops in blood volume that make you woozy. Eating balanced meals maintains steady glucose levels crucial for brain function. If medications cause hypotension-related dizziness, doctors may tweak doses accordingly.

In cases involving heart disease or anemia, targeted therapies like iron supplementation or cardiac interventions come into play after proper diagnosis.

Navigating Neurological Causes Safely

Neurological disorders require specialist care often involving neurologists. Migraines linked with vertigo respond well to migraine-specific treatments including preventive drugs like beta-blockers or calcium channel blockers along with lifestyle modifications reducing triggers such as stress or lack of sleep.

For MS patients experiencing dizziness due to demyelination effects on balance nerves, disease-modifying therapies help slow progression while symptom management includes physical therapy focused on stability training.

In stroke scenarios causing sudden onset dizzy spells plus other neurological signs like weakness—immediate emergency care is critical to minimize lasting damage.
